## Service Accounts — PickPath Optimizer

The PickPath optimizer runs under the `svc-pickpath` service account, which holds read access to the Binfield warehouse layout tables and write access to the pick-list queue only. Reviewers should confirm that no code path escalates beyond these scopes. Calls to the internal RouteCost service authenticate via a static key injected at deploy time by the Harnwell config loader. For local verification, use the staging key below.

service key, tadup-tahog: zpat7_wB1tnEL

Handover note — Crumbwheel order cutoffs.

Welcome aboard. The bakery cutoff rule in Crumbwheel closes same-day orders at 14:00 local to each storefront, not UTC — this has bitten us twice. Holiday overrides live in the calendar service and take precedence silently, so always check there first when a cutoff looks wrong. To unlock the calendar service's admin console after a restart, enter the recovery passphrase below.

vault phrase of bagap-bahaf = silion-pelox-sorox-casdor-quenwyn-fraax-eliox-praael-kelion-quenvan-kasox-rusael-norius-belvan

## Deployment

Glyphsense is the service that sniffs character encodings on uploaded text files before they reach the Plumwood ingest pipeline. It ships as a single container and runs behind the internal gateway in both staging and production. Support staff do not need to rebuild anything: redeploys are triggered from the Larchbay dashboard, and the detector models are baked into the image. If a customer reports garbled output, check that their environment matches the defaults first. The standard configuration values are listed below.

deployment values, fahap-hahaf:
[casdor]
port = 9200
region = south-2
host = casdor.qirvanworks.corp
timeout_ms = 3000
retries = 4